In a bowl, combine the low-fat quark, spelt flour, baking powder, sweetener of choice, chocolate drops, and a pinch of salt. Mix all ingredients well until combined.
Remove the mixture from the bowl and knead the dough thoroughly on a work surface.
Sprinkle the dough with a little flour and roll it out into a large square.
Cut the dough into smaller squares, and then cut each square diagonally into triangles.
Roll up all the triangles from the wide end to the tip to form croissant shapes.
Place the croissants on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per and bake in the oven at 180°C (350°F) for 20 to 23 minutes.
